Ambalangoda

Hotels in Ambalangoda

Enter your dates for the latest hotel rates and availability.

Swipe up to view more

Frequently Asked Questions

How much does it cost to stay in a hotel in Ambalangoda?

The average price for hotels in Ambalangoda is DKK 327 for weekdays, and DKK 333 for weekends (Friday–Saturday).

What are the best hotels in Ambalangoda?

From business trips to holiday stays, Ambalangoda offers a wide selection of popular hotels to suit every need. The Vitamin Sea (from DKK 169), Shangrela Beach Resort by Ark (from DKK 146) and Sathis Villa (from DKK 152) are excellent options for your stay.

What are the best sap hotels in Ambalangoda?

Planning a relaxing trip? Staying at a spa hotel can make your experience even more enjoyable. The Vitamin Sea (from DKK 169), Hotel Italia (from DKK 205) and R Degrees (from DKK 379) are great choices for spa hotels offering quality services.

Which hotels in Ambalangoda provide fitness facilities?

Shangrela Beach Resort by Ark (from DKK 146) and R Degrees (from DKK 379) offer fitness facilities to help you stay active while away from home. Keep up with your fitness routine even when traveling!

Which hotels in Ambalangoda have the best breakfast?

Which hotels in Ambalangoda have swimming pools?

The Vitamin Sea (from DKK 169), Shangrela Beach Resort by Ark (from DKK 146) and The Sri Heritage (from DKK 177) are great choices for hotels with swimming pools. Stay at any of these hotels to relax by the pool and make the most of your stay.

Total Properties46
Number of Reviews131
Lowest PriceDKK 76
Highest PriceDKK 1,404
Average Price (Weekends)DKK 333
Average Price (Weekdays)DKK 327